Sessions were held for 7-11 year olds at Sir Basil Arthur Park on July 18th and 19th. Four of our club's players went along - Hannah Soper, Laney Stanistreet, Peter Fish and Jonathan Fish.
Altogether there were about 30 children there, and with great coaches they tried out their skills, learnt some new ones, and had a lot of fun on the way.
